(1)As used in this section:
(a)"Blended or hybrid instruction" means instruction through both in-person and virtual instruction.
(b)"In-person instruction" means instruction in the physical presence of an individual employed by an Idaho local education agency.
(c)"Virtual instruction" means synchronous or asynchronous instruction primarily through the use of technology via the internet in a distributed environment.
(2)The constitution of the state of Idaho, section 1, article IX, charges the legislature with the duty to establish and maintain a general, uniform, and thorough system of public, free common schools.
